Cottonwood, AZ: what the federal noise map shows

At Cottonwood, AZ, road, rail and aircraft noise all fall below the 45 dB(A) floor BTS's national map can distinguish from silence. Treat this as Cottonwood's one representative point, not a promise about every block in it, BTS's map wasn't built to resolve individual streets.
